Blackstone (NYSE:BX –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 23rd. The asset manager reported $1.52 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.34 by $0.18. The firm had revenue of $5.04 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.42 billion. Blackstone had a return on equity of 23.77% and a net margin of 21.84%.The company’s revenue was up 35.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.98 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ts predict that Blackstone Inc. will post 5.99 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Blackstone Increases Dividend
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, August 10th. Investors of record on Monday, August 3rd were issued a dividend of $1.29 per share. The ex-dividend date was Monday, August 3rd. This represents a $5.16 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.6%. This is an increase from Blackstone’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.16. Blackstone’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 115.44%.

About Blackstone
Blackstone Inc (NYSE: BX) is a global investment firm focused on alternative asset management. Founded in 1985 by Stephen A. Schwarzman and Peter G. Peterson and headquartered in New York City, the firm organizes and manages investment vehicles that acquire and operate businesses, real estate and credit investments, as well as provide hedge fund solutions and other alternative strategies for institutional and individual investors.
